Design and Implementation of Traditional Chinese Medicine Education Visualization Platform Based on Virtual Reality Technology
The development of science and technology had brought about many changes in life of human being. Research of Virtual Reality (VR) technology has already made important progress in the world. It is widely used in military, industrial development and education. Traditional Chinese Medicine (TCM) is a valuable asset in China. The development of the education of TCM is very important. Keeping in view the development of TCM in the field of education this paper has been written on TCM visualisation education platform based on Virtual Reality (VR) technology. We focused on the idea, platform structure and implementation on method of this system.
